Infrared terrain background simulation is of great significance to virtual battlefield environment. The access to the information of material and boundary is lack of efficient method in the infrared terrain background simulation based on the remote sensing images. A method of remote sensing image automatic classification was proposed to solve the problem. The material category was determined and a sample library was built. The classifier with the sample library was trained which extracted features. The input images were classified by the trained classifier. Boundary information and material category information after post-processing were obtained. Experimental results show that the proposed method can provide front-end data for IR simulation of terrain background efficiently.
